A federal judge branded conditions at the Broadview immigration detention center near Chicago “disgusting,” calling sleeping next to overflowing toilets unconstitutional.
Detainees say they were denied food, water and medical care, then coerced into signing documents they couldn’t understand, unknowingly forfeiting legal rights.
Mexican immigrants held there testified about overcrowded cells with 150 people, sleeping on floors without beds, blankets, toothbrushes or basic hygiene supplies.
